Mayonie Productions has officially welcomed award-winning South African singer, songwriter and performer Moonchild Sanelly to its artist roster.

The company will represent the genre-defying artist for bookings across South Africa and the African continent.

Known for her fearless creativity, distinctive visual identity and electrifying live performances, Moonchild Sanelly has carved out a unique space within South Africa’s music landscape and established herself as an internationally recognised performer.

Her Sound. Her Identity. Her Global Stage

Her signature sound, which she describes as “Future Ghetto Funk,” draws from a dynamic mix of electronic music, gqom, amapiano, alternative pop and broader African club influences. It is a sound that reflects her unapologetic artistic identity while continuing to push the boundaries of contemporary African music.

Over the years, Moonchild Sanelly has taken her music and high-energy performances from some of South Africa’s biggest stages to international audiences and platforms, building a career firmly rooted in South African culture, sound and identity while connecting with audiences around the world.

The next chapter begins

Her addition to the Mayonie Productions roster marks a new chapter focused on expanding her live opportunities across the continent. Through the partnership, Mayonie Productions will facilitate booking opportunities spanning festivals, concerts, corporate events, cultural platforms and other live experiences across South Africa and Africa.

Commenting on the announcement, Mayonie Productions Founder Zakes Bantwini had this to say:

“Moonchild Sanelly represents the kind of fearless, distinctive and culturally rooted artistry that continues to shape the future of African music, We are excited to welcome her to the Mayonie Productions roster and to create more opportunities for audiences across South Africa and the continent to experience her incredible live energy,” said Zakes Bantwini.

The partnership comes at an exciting time for Moonchild Sanelly, who is also preparing to release a new album later in 2026, adding further momentum to what promises to be another important chapter in her career.
